Drug Facts

TITANIUM DIOXIDE 3.7% / ZINC OXIDE 7.55%

Sunscreen

Helps prevent sunburn

For external use only.

Keep out of eyes. Rinse with water to remove.

Rash or irritation develops and lasts

Keep out of reach of children. If swallowed,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center right away.

Apply smoothly before sun exposure and as needed. Children under 6 months of age : ask a doctor
